Edith’s review:

I loved this book about Jack the horse who visited the care homes of people with dementia, I really enjoyed the part where he rubbed his bottom against the wheelchair and how he was cheeky and stole cakes. I think all the people in the care homes must love getting visits from Jack as mum told me this was based on a true story. I loved the pictures in this book as they were different too my other books and were like actual paintings.

Mum’s comments:

I loved reading this book with Edith as my Nanna had dementia and was in a care home but Edith wouldn’t remember as she was too young so I could use this book to help her relate. The illustrations were lovely too and the softness them complimented the story nicely.

About the Book

Jack Brock was enjoying his daily walk when his owner suddenly started taking him somewhere new, a care home.

Here Jack meets so many new people including Alma, Bob and Audrey and, although a little shy at first, Jack manages to bring a smile to everyone’s faces through his silly antics.

Author / Illustrator

Ali Stearn

Ali Stearn is the owner of Jack Brock. In her spare time she takes Jack to care homes voluntarily and, together, they support those living with Dementia, having raised over £25k to date. She started illustrating Jack Brock Christmas cards in 2019 with proceeds of the sales going to dementia charities local to her home in Norwich.
